Engineering and Architecture Firms Cannot Create Math-Driven Proposals in CRM

Engineering, architecture, and technical project firms need CRM tools that support configurable mathematical expressions for automatic cost calculations, volume estimates, and area-based pricing in proposals. Generic CRM tools force reliance on external spreadsheets for proposal math, creating workflow fragmentation. This niche but structural gap affects a globally significant professional services segment.
